What is NDIS Air flow Training?

Understanding the Basics

NDIS ventilation training is created to equip healthcare providers with the skills and expertise required to handle clients who call for ventilatory assistance. This includes individuals with respiratory failure or those who require aid as a result of problems such as neurological problems or muscular dystrophy.

Importance of Air flow Training

Why is ventilation training so essential? For starters, inappropriate management can cause major problems. By undertaking appropriate ventilator training, registered nurses and health ventilation training care professionals can make certain reliable respiratory tract monitoring and boost client outcomes.

Basic Ventilator Course: An Overview

What You Will certainly Learn

The basic ventilator course gives fundamental expertise about different kinds of ventilators, their setups, and just how they function. Individuals will certainly learn:

    Basic principles of mechanical ventilation Types of ventilators used in clinical settings Initial arrangement treatments for numerous settings of ventilation

Course Format

Typically, these courses incorporate theoretical knowledge with hands-on technique. Anticipate a mix of talks, presentations, and simulations that resemble real-life scenarios.
